TRUCK IS RUNNING LEAN & NOT SURE WHY

I HAVE NOTICED THIS TWICE SINCE I HAVE HAD THE TRUCK. AT START UP THE TRUCK STARTS POPPING THRU THE EXHAUST ONLY WHEN I GIVE IT GAS TO MAKE IT GO. WHILE SITTING STILL I LOOKED THIS TIME AND SEEN THE A/F GAUGE AT 17 TO 18 AND NOTCHED THE CHECK ENGINE LIGHT WAS OFF (TRUCK HAS THE CATLESS MIDS ON IT AND THE CHECK ENGINE IS ALWAYS ON) ONCE I WAS ABLE TO GET GOING AROUND 30 – 40 SHE CLEARED UP AND THE A/F CAME DOWN TO 14.

ANY IDEAS WHAT THIS COULD BE?:dontknow:

17 or 18 is lean, not rich.
 
I had the same issue and replaced both upstream O2 sensors and my issue was resolved
 
17-18 is fine at idle, under full throttle and load is what matters. If he was running 17's at full throttle this discussion would not be about rough running it would be about "who can rebuild my engine".

Im pretty sure the rear o2 sensors can be shut off in the programming, and the bung filled with a plug on the rears. Even with that p0420 code for the sensors on, it has no effect on the fuel or timing. Was the popping backfiring? Does it do it after its warm, shut off and restarted? Shot in the dark, but could be air intake temperature sensor. Shouldnt be much guesswork being you have the AF meter. Not sure why lean would cause popping.

Have you seen any new codes come up? Sounds like a Crankshaft position sensor or cam position sensor? I had the Crank sensor go out in mine and it's like 7$ to replace. It did it slowly until it wouldn't run any longer. Replaced and all was well in the world.
